How do you quote Lion King?

How to cite “The Lion King” (movie)

  1. APA. Allers, R., & Minkoff, R. (1994). The Lion King. Buena Vista Pictures.
  2. Chicago. Allers, Roger, and Rob Minkoff. 1994. The Lion King. United States: Buena Vista Pictures.
  3. MLA. Allers, Roger, and Rob Minkoff. The Lion King. Buena Vista Pictures, 1994.

What The Lion King teaches us?

For more than 20 years, since a 1994 version of the film, and now with a new remake, The Lion King has taught children lessons about the circle of life, the importance of following your dreams and the possibility of learning from mistakes.
